I'm using cocoon 2.1.7 under jdk 1.5.
I've written some basic actions, but am puzzled that these actions seem to
need a "warm up". If I leave the system running overnight, first hit in the
morning will be terribly slow. After that, all is ok.
My Actions do not implement "Threadsafe", so they should be poolable. Still,
adding pooling attributes (pool min/max/grow) to the declaration doesn't
seem to help.
Can anyone give me pointers where to start looking to resolve this, please?
